About the role

As a defense mission professional, you will develop innovative modeling and simulation solutions that strengthen Joint Force readiness and support missions critical to national security. In this role, you will plan, coordinate, integrate, and synchronize modeling and simulation capabilities to enable realistic representations of non-kinetic effects—including Electromagnetic Spectrum Operations (EMSO), Electronic Warfare (EW), and cyberspace operations—within complex military space and Joint training environments.

You will collaborate with exercise planners, operational subject matter experts, mission partners, software developers, intelligence professionals, and government stakeholders to identify exercise objectives, determine non-kinetic effects (NKE) modeling and simulation requirements, and integrate capabilities that realistically represent offensive and defensive non-kinetic operations. Serving as a trusted advisor throughout the Joint Exercise Life Cycle (JELC), you will translate training objectives, operational scenarios, and threat representations into executable modeling and simulation plans supporting exercise design, planning conferences, execution, and after-action analysis.

Your work will improve exercise realism, enable tactics, techniques, and procedures (TTP) refinement, support operational concept development, and strengthen the Joint Force's ability to plan, execute, and assess non-kinetic operations in contested environments.

Qualifications

  • Experience supporting United States Space Command, United States Space Force, United States Cyber Command, United States Strategic Command, National Space Defense Center, Combined Space Operations Center, or other National Security Space organizations.
  • Experience supporting Tier 1 or Joint exercises, including Initial Planning Conferences (IPC), Mid Planning Conferences (MPC), Final Planning Conferences (FPC), Master Scenario Events List (MSEL) development, exercise execution, and after-action activities.
  • Experience developing or integrating scenarios involving electromagnetic interference, jamming, spoofing, cyber effects, communications degradation, command and control disruption, or other non-kinetic effects.
  • Experience integrating live, virtual, and constructive (LVC) modeling and simulation capabilities into military exercises.
  • Experience developing exercise scenarios that integrate NKE with Space Domain Awareness, Orbital Warfare, Missile Warning and Missile Defense, Command and Control, or Joint All-Domain Operations.
  • Knowledge of modeling and simulation tools, frameworks, and environments used to represent EMSO, EW, cyber, space, or Joint operational effects (e.g., Systems Tool Kit (STK), Advanced Framework for Simulation, Integration, and Modeling (AFSIM), Paladin, Swarm, Kronos).
